    Counting permutation equivalent degree six binary polynomials invariant under the cyclic group

    The article of record as published may be found at http://dx.doi.org/10.1007/s00200-016-0294-7In this paper we find an exact formula for the number of affine equivalence classes under permutations for binary polynomials degree d = 6 invariant under the cyclic group (also, called monomial rotation symmetric), for a prime number of variables; this extends previous work for 2 ≤ d ≤ 5
